"Crucible of Cultures
ISTANBUL -- Babylon, Byzantium, Constantinople: one must employ words with the weight of centuries to write about Turkey. Birthplace of Roman kings, Trojan warriors, Sufi saints and Old Testament prophets, Turkey was home to the Apostles John and Paul in the earliest days of Christianity. Mother Mary is said to have lived and died here, not far from Ephesus, where Paul preached his radical new ideas to the curious masses. Part of the ancient Babylonian empire – including the cave believed to be the home of the prophet Abraham – extended into what is now modern-day Turkey."
